All That We Are
Darlene Zschech's song "All That We Are" is a worship anthem that celebrates the sacrifice of Jesus Christ and the victory of His resurrection. The lyrics reflect on how Christ gave up His crown and took up the cross so that believers could receive grace and be transformed. The song emphasizes surrender, declaring that all we are is for God's glory and for the name of Jesus. It also touches on the finished work of Christ, the power of His name, and the response of praise and thanksgiving. The overall message is one of devotion, gratitude, and commitment to live for God's honor.
